    Getting There

    Auto Rickshaw

    If you are at the Fort Kochi Bus Station, take an auto rickshaw directly to Fort Nagar, Mattancherry. The ride will take about 10 minutes. Just tell the driver 'Fort Kochi' or show them the address 'Fort Nagar, Mattancherry, Kochi, Kerala 682002'. Make sure to negotiate the fare beforehand if possible.

    Walking

    Starting from the Chinese Fishing Nets in Fort Kochi, walk along the beach road towards the Mattancherry Palace (Dutch Palace). This will take you about 20-25 minutes of leisurely walking. The route is well marked, and you can enjoy the coastal scenery along the way. Once you reach the palace, continue straight for about 500 meters and you will arrive at Fort Nagar.

    Public Bus

    From Ernakulam, take a public bus heading towards Fort Kochi. Once you reach the Fort Kochi bus stop, you can either walk or take an auto rickshaw to Fort Nagar, which is about 1.5 kilometers away. If walking, head straight on the main road and follow the signs to Fort Kochi, then look for Fort Nagar on your right.

    Bicycle Rental

    If you enjoy cycling, rent a bicycle from one of the rental shops in Fort Kochi. From the center, cycle towards Mattancherry, following the road signs. The distance is approximately 3 kilometers and should take around 15-20 minutes. Once you reach Mattancherry, you can park your bicycle and walk to Fort Nagar.

    Discover more about Fort kochi

    Fort Kochi, located in the picturesque city of Kochi, Kerala, is a must-visit destination for tourists looking to experience a rich tapestry of history, culture, and scenic beauty. This charming coastal area showcases a unique blend of Indian, Portuguese, Dutch, and British influences, evident in its well-preserved colonial architecture and vibrant streets. Visitors can stroll along the iconic Chinese fishing nets, which have become a symbol of the region, and watch local fishermen at work, creating a picturesque scene against the backdrop of the Arabian Sea. The area's historical significance is further highlighted by landmarks such as St. Francis Church, the oldest European church in India, and the impressive Mattancherry Palace, which offers a glimpse into the royal history of Kochi. Art enthusiasts will find a thriving contemporary art scene, with numerous galleries showcasing local talent and unique installations. The annual Kochi-Muziris Biennale, a prominent international art festival, attracts visitors from around the globe. Fort Kochi is also known for its vibrant eateries, where tourists can indulge in authentic Kerala cuisine, featuring fresh seafood and traditional dishes. The lively atmosphere, combined with the warm hospitality of the locals, makes Fort Kochi an unforgettable experience for travelers seeking both relaxation and cultural immersion. Whether you're exploring its historical sites, savoring delicious local fare, or simply enjoying a sunset by the beach, Fort Kochi promises a memorable adventure.
